About Alcohol Rehab
Alcohol-use-disorder programs typically begin with 5–10 days of medically supervised detox to manage tremor, autonomic instability, and seizure risk, followed by residential or outpatient therapy. Naltrexone (oral or extended-release Vivitrol) and acamprosate are the most common pharmacotherapies; disulfiram suits motivated patients with strong external accountability.

Insurance Accepted in Tennessee
Tennessee has not expanded Medicaid; coverage for low-income adults is narrower than in expansion states, and county-funded and church-funded programs play a larger role. Under the federal Mental Health Parity and Addiction Equity Act, most plans must cover substance-use treatment at parity with medical/surgical benefits.

State Licensing & Oversight
Regulator: Tennessee Department of Mental Health and Substance Abuse Services (TDMHSAS). All listed facilities operate under Tennessee state licensure; verify any provider against the regulator's directory.
- Alcohol and Drug Abuse Treatment Facility License
- Residential Treatment License
- Non-Residential Treatment License
Renewal cadence: Annual.
